Genshin Impact Jagarico Will Feature Popular Characters

Calbee announced a collaboration with HoYoVerse, in which Genshin Impact editions of Jagarico will appear in supermarkets and convenience stores. You’ll be able to find them from mid-March 2024 until late April 2024.

Recommended Videos

This appears to be exclusive to Japan, much like the Sushiro one. There’s not much information about it at the present. However, according to Calbee’s Tweet, this collaboration is specifically for the large-sized cups of the salad-flavored Jagarico. Popular characters will appear on the lid and on the cup itself. The characters are in chibi form, like how they appear as stamps in-game. The characters on the Calbee advert are Nilou, Xiangling, Mona, Kaeya, Kaveh, and Itto.

Genshin Impact Version 4.5 will come out on March 13, 2024. This mid-March 2024 release date for the new patch is likely the reason why Calbee will also put out its Genshin Impact Jagarico snacks from mid-March 2024. Version 4.5 will only have Chiori, a 5-star Geo Sword character, who will be new. Itto, Kazuha, and Neuvillette will have their re-runs as well. New content includes a Character Training Guide, Chronicles Wish Event Wish, and the Alchemical Ascension seasonal event.

Genshin Impact is readily available for the PS4, PS5, Windows PC, and mobile devices.
